Pan, Z., Zhu, M., Zhu, Y. & Jia, L., August 2017. A new antiarch placoderm from the Emsian (Early Devonian) of Wuding, Yunnan, China. <i>Alcheringa 42</i>, 10–21. ISSN 0311-5518. <i>Wufengshania magniforaminis</i>, a new genus and species of the Euantiarcha (Placodermi: Antiarcha), is described from the late Emsian (Early Devonian) of Wuding, Yunnan, southwestern China. The referred specimens were three-dimensionally preserved in black shales, allowing a high-resolution computed tomography reconstruction of anatomical details. The new euantiarch is characterized by a large orbital fenestra, an arched exoskeletal band around the orbital fenestra and a developed obtected nuchal area of the skull roof. Maximum parsimony analysis, using a revised data-set of antiarchs with 44 taxa and 66 characters, resolves <i>Wufengshania</i> gen. nov. as a member of the Bothriolepididae, which is characterized by the presence of the infraorbital sensory canal diverging on the lateral plate, and the nuchal plate with orbital facets. 本文记述了真反甲亚目(Euantiarcha,盾皮鱼纲(Placodermi):反甲亚纲(Antiarcha))一新属新种大孔武定鱼(Wufengshania magniforaminis),其化石产自中国西南云南省武定的晚艾姆斯期(早泥盆世(Early Devonian))地层。归入本种的标本保存在黑色页岩(black shales)中,呈三维立体保存状态,可通过高分辨率计算机断层扫描(computed tomography)重建其解剖学细节。该新真反甲类的鉴别特征包括:硕大的眶孔(orbital fenestra)、环绕眶孔的拱形外骨骼带(exoskeletal band),以及颅顶(skull roof)发育的骨化颈区(obtected nuchal area)。
研究团队采用修正后的反甲类数据集(包含44个类群(taxa)与66个性状(characters))开展最大简约法系统发育分析(maximum parsimony analysis),结果显示新属武定鱼属(Wufengshania)gen. nov.隶属于沟鳞鱼科(Bothriolepididae),该科的鉴别特征为:眶下感觉管(infraorbital sensory canal)在侧片(lateral plate)上分叉,以及颈板(nuchal plate)具有眶面(orbital facets)。新的系统发育分析支持滇鱼属(Dianolepis)与沟鳞鱼科构成姊妹群关系(sister group relationship)。同期产自该新类群邻区的禄劝鱼属(Luquanolepis)被归入星鳞鱼亚目(Asterolepidoidei),代表了该亚目最基部且最古老的成员。
